피드로 돌아가기
GnokeOps: Host Your Own AI House Party
Dev.toDev.to
Infrastructure

Vendor Lock-in 제거를 위한 AI-Agnostic Sovereign Host 아키텍처 설계

GnokeOps: Host Your Own AI House Party

Ekong Ikpe2026년 5월 23일4intermediate

Context

AI-native 플랫폼의 편의성으로 인한 인프라 의존성 심화 및 데이터 소유권 상실 문제 발생. 특정 모델이나 벤더의 생태계에 종속되어 워크플로우 전체가 외부 플랫폼의 제약 사항에 묶이는 구조적 한계 노출.

Technical Solution

  • Model Agnostic 설계를 통한 엔드포인트 및 어댑터 교체 기반의 모델 교체 가능 구조 확보
  • Security Boundary Layer(The Bouncer) 도입을 통한 디렉토리 및 실행 권한의 엄격한 제어 체계 구축
  • Local AI(Llama, Qwen)를 활용한 온프레미스 기반의 요청 검증 및 보안 필터링 로직 구현
  • Stateless Visitor 패턴을 적용하여 AI 모델이 로컬 환경에 일시적으로 진입해 작업 후 퇴장하는 실행 모델 설계
  • 서버 사이드 트리거 기반의 온디맨드 디스패치 구조를 통한 유휴 리소스 낭비 최소화
  • PHP, SQLite 등 경량 스택을 활용하여 외부 클라우드 의존성 없는 독립적 Runtime 환경 구축

- AI 모델을 핵심 인프라가 아닌 교체 가능한 Execution Engine으로 정의하고 있는가 - 모델의 권한을 최소화하는 Security Boundary Layer가 파일시스템 진입점에 설계되었는가 - 데이터와 환경의 소유권을 유지하기 위해 Stateless한 AI 진입 구조를 채택했는가 - 특정 벤더의 API에 종속되지 않는 Adapter 패턴을 통해 모델 전환 유연성을 확보했는가

원문 읽기